Abstract

A signal propagating in wireless channels encounters fading effect, which degrades the performance of wireless communication systems. Information about the performance of communication systems is significant for assuring service availability and sustainability, as well as quality of service in telecommunication networks. Bit error rate, average output Signal to Noise Ratio, outage probability, amount of fading, level crossing rate, etc. are some of the important performance measures for communication systems. One of the efficient counteracting methods that can modify the disparaging outcome of fading for superior performance of receiver is the diversity combining. Some of the important diversity combining schemes are selection combining, equal gain combining and maximal ratio combining. A comparative study of these diversity receivers over two wave diffuse power have been carried out to evaluate the impact of fading parameters K and Δ on their performance.
